Recap: Copenhagen Golden Knights vs. Belleville Henderson Central Panthers

With a playoff game on the line, the Copenhagen Golden Knights rose to the challenge on Tuesday. They blew past the Panthers 51-31. That's another feather in the cap for Copenhagen, who also won these teams' last head-to-head.

It was another big night for Samuel Carroll, who dropped a double-double on 21 points and 11 rebounds. He is on a roll when it comes to blocks, as he's now posted two or more in the last 17 games he's played. The team also got some help courtesy of Caden Miller, who scored 13 points.

Copenhagen pushed their record up to 13-6 with that victory, which was their fourth straight at home. Those victories were due in large part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 54.0 points per game. As for Belleville Henderson Central,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 4-7.

Copenhagen does not have any more games scheduled as of now. Belleville Henderson Central also has no future games currently scheduled.
